Output 2d7e1b6f251af85b2fe7a8dacaeb01ed0c53853628307d4481e61a1111e1538d:0

value
636763
script pubkey
OP_0 OP_PUSHBYTES_20 58eb985709cb598bdac79a1dc30dfa428f3be450
address
tb1qtr4es4cfedvchkk8ngwuxr06g28nhezstfchjd
transaction
2d7e1b6f251af85b2fe7a8dacaeb01ed0c53853628307d4481e61a1111e1538d
confirmations
103692
spent
false

1 Sat Range